verb
1
[
intransitive
I
,
transitive
T
]
CONTROL
to control someone or something or to have more
importance
than other people or things
支配,控制,主宰
The industry is dominated by five multinational companies.
这个行业受五家跨国公司控制。
New Orleans dominated throughout the game.
新奥尔良队自始至终都控制着这场比赛。
Her loud voice totally dominated the conversation.
她的大嗓门完全主导着这场谈话。
Education issues dominated the election campaign.
教育问题成了这次选举活动的主要辩题。
2
[
transitive
T
]
HIGH
to be larger and more
noticeable
than anything else in a place
耸立于,比
…
高,俯视
The cathedral dominates the city.
大教堂俯视全城。
